Brown v. Board of Education, 347 US 483 (1954)
School Segregation
The U.S. Supreme Court ruled in Brown v. Board of Education that racially separate educational facilities were inherently unequal. This case led to the desegregation of public schools in the U.S.

The Warren Court ruled segregated schools were unconstitutional in Brown v Board of Education, (1954), and ordered integration to take place "at all deliberate speed" in Brown v Board of Education II, (1955).
